<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="de">
	<id>https://www.deskmodder.de/wiki/index.php?action=history&amp;feed=atom&amp;title=Prim%C3%A4ren_Monitor_%28Hauptanzeige%29_einstellen_und_%C3%BCberpr%C3%BCfen</id>
	<title>Primären Monitor (Hauptanzeige) einstellen und überprüfen - Versionsgeschichte</title>
	<link rel="self" type="application/atom+xml" href="https://www.deskmodder.de/wiki/index.php?action=history&amp;feed=atom&amp;title=Prim%C3%A4ren_Monitor_%28Hauptanzeige%29_einstellen_und_%C3%BCberpr%C3%BCfen"/>
	<link rel="alternate" type="text/html" href="https://www.deskmodder.de/wiki/index.php?title=Prim%C3%A4ren_Monitor_(Hauptanzeige)_einstellen_und_%C3%BCberpr%C3%BCfen&amp;action=history"/>
	<updated>2026-05-01T12:32:38Z</updated>
	<subtitle>Versionsgeschichte dieser Seite in Deskmodder Wiki</subtitle>
	<generator>MediaWiki 1.43.8</generator>
	<entry>
		<id>https://www.deskmodder.de/wiki/index.php?title=Prim%C3%A4ren_Monitor_(Hauptanzeige)_einstellen_und_%C3%BCberpr%C3%BCfen&amp;diff=28146&amp;oldid=prev</id>
		<title>Moinmoin: Die Seite wurde neu angelegt: „Kategorie:Windows 11  Hat man mehrere Monitore, dann hat man die Möglichkeit (auch) unter Windows 11 den primären und den sekundären Monitor einstellen. Auf dem primären (Hauptanzeige) wird immer die Taskleiste angezeigt, die dann auf die anderen Monitore erweitert werden kann.  &#039;&#039;&#039;Dieses Tutorial ist für die Windows 11 22H2 und höher geeignet.&#039;&#039;&#039; *Windows 11 Welche Version ist installiert {{Absatz}} {{Wichtig11}}  Datei:Windows 11 Monitor…“</title>
		<link rel="alternate" type="text/html" href="https://www.deskmodder.de/wiki/index.php?title=Prim%C3%A4ren_Monitor_(Hauptanzeige)_einstellen_und_%C3%BCberpr%C3%BCfen&amp;diff=28146&amp;oldid=prev"/>
		<updated>2026-04-29T09:33:45Z</updated>

		<summary type="html">&lt;p&gt;Die Seite wurde neu angelegt: „&lt;a href=&quot;/wiki/index.php?title=Kategorie:Windows_11&quot; title=&quot;Kategorie:Windows 11&quot;&gt;Kategorie:Windows 11&lt;/a&gt;  Hat man mehrere Monitore, dann hat man die Möglichkeit (auch) unter Windows 11 den primären und den sekundären Monitor einstellen. Auf dem primären (Hauptanzeige) wird immer die Taskleiste angezeigt, die dann auf die anderen Monitore erweitert werden kann.  &amp;#039;&amp;#039;&amp;#039;Dieses Tutorial ist für die Windows 11 22H2 und höher geeignet.&amp;#039;&amp;#039;&amp;#039; *&lt;a href=&quot;/wiki/index.php?title=Windows_11_Welche_Version_ist_installiert&quot; title=&quot;Windows 11 Welche Version ist installiert&quot;&gt;Windows 11 Welche Version ist installiert&lt;/a&gt; {{Absatz}} {{Wichtig11}}  Datei:Windows 11 Monitor…“&lt;/p&gt;
&lt;p&gt;&lt;b&gt;Neue Seite&lt;/b&gt;&lt;/p&gt;&lt;div&gt;[[Kategorie:Windows 11]]&lt;br /&gt;
&lt;br /&gt;
Hat man mehrere Monitore, dann hat man die Möglichkeit (auch) unter Windows 11 den primären und den sekundären Monitor einstellen. Auf dem primären (Hauptanzeige) wird immer die Taskleiste angezeigt, die dann auf die anderen Monitore erweitert werden kann.&lt;br /&gt;
&lt;br /&gt;
&amp;#039;&amp;#039;&amp;#039;Dieses Tutorial ist für die Windows 11 22H2 und höher geeignet.&amp;#039;&amp;#039;&amp;#039;&lt;br /&gt;
*[[Windows 11 Welche Version ist installiert]]&lt;br /&gt;
{{Absatz}}&lt;br /&gt;
{{Wichtig11}}&lt;br /&gt;
&lt;br /&gt;
[[Datei:Windows 11 Monitor Hauptanzeige einstellen 001.jpg|thumb]]&lt;br /&gt;
&lt;br /&gt;
In den Einstellungen -&amp;gt; System -&amp;gt; Bildschirm kommt man an die Einstellungen für den Monitor. Im oberen Fenster könnt ihr mit gedrückter linker Maustaste die Monitore wechseln. Somit braucht ihr nicht die Kabel neu stecken. Windows erkennt dann (wie im Bild zu sehen) den zweiten als Hauptmonitor.&lt;br /&gt;
&lt;br /&gt;
{{Absatz}}&lt;br /&gt;
&lt;br /&gt;
[[Datei:Windows 11 Monitor Hauptanzeige einstellen 002.jpg|thumb]]&lt;br /&gt;
&lt;br /&gt;
Ist der Hauptmonitor eingestellt, wird der Eintrag &amp;quot;Diese Anzeige als Hauptanzeige verwenden&amp;quot; grau hinterlegt. Möchte man den Hauptmonitor ändern, so muss man den anderen Monitor auswählen (anklicken)&lt;br /&gt;
{{Absatz}}&lt;br /&gt;
[[Datei:Windows 11 Monitor Hauptanzeige einstellen 003.jpg|thumb]]&lt;br /&gt;
&lt;br /&gt;
Dort ist dann die Möglichkeit gegeben den anderen als Hauptmonitor einzustellen. Danach wird dann dieser Eintrag grau hinterlegt sein.&lt;br /&gt;
&lt;br /&gt;
{{Absatz}}&lt;br /&gt;
&lt;br /&gt;
==Monitore identifizieren mit einem PowerShell-Skript==&lt;br /&gt;
&lt;br /&gt;
Möchte man nicht in die Einstellungen, dann kann man auch ein PowerShell-Skript nehmen, welches Jürgen Klein uns zur Verfügung gestellt hat. Das Skript zeigt an, welcher Monitor der primäre ist und welche die dann folgenden sekundären Monitore.&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
&amp;lt;pre&amp;gt;&amp;lt;nowiki&amp;gt;chcp 65001 &amp;gt; $null&lt;br /&gt;
[Console]::OutputEncoding = [System.Text.Encoding]::UTF8&lt;br /&gt;
[Console]::InputEncoding  = [System.Text.Encoding]::UTF8&lt;br /&gt;
&lt;br /&gt;
Add-Type -AssemblyName System.Windows.Forms&lt;br /&gt;
[System.Windows.Forms.Application]::EnableVisualStyles()&lt;br /&gt;
&lt;br /&gt;
$ordered = [System.Windows.Forms.Screen]::AllScreens |&lt;br /&gt;
    Sort-Object @{Expression = {$_.Primary}; Descending = $true}, @{Expression = {$_.WorkingArea.Left}}, @{Expression = {$_.WorkingArea.Top}}&lt;br /&gt;
&lt;br /&gt;
$forms = @()&lt;br /&gt;
$monitorCount = 1&lt;br /&gt;
&lt;br /&gt;
# ApplicationContext für zentrale Steuerung der Message-Loop&lt;br /&gt;
$context = New-Object System.Windows.Forms.ApplicationContext&lt;br /&gt;
&lt;br /&gt;
foreach ($screen in $ordered) {&lt;br /&gt;
    $form = New-Object System.Windows.Forms.Form&lt;br /&gt;
    $form.StartPosition = &amp;#039;Manual&amp;#039;&lt;br /&gt;
    $form.FormBorderStyle = &amp;#039;None&amp;#039;&lt;br /&gt;
    $form.BackColor = &amp;#039;Black&amp;#039;&lt;br /&gt;
    $form.Opacity = 0.65&lt;br /&gt;
    $form.Size = New-Object System.Drawing.Size(400,300)&lt;br /&gt;
&lt;br /&gt;
    $x = $screen.WorkingArea.Left + [int](($screen.WorkingArea.Width - $form.Width)/2)&lt;br /&gt;
    $y = $screen.WorkingArea.Top  + [int](($screen.WorkingArea.Height - $form.Height)/2)&lt;br /&gt;
    $form.Location = New-Object System.Drawing.Point($x, $y)&lt;br /&gt;
    $form.TopMost = $true&lt;br /&gt;
&lt;br /&gt;
# Suffix vorher bestimmen (kompatibel mit PS 5.1)&lt;br /&gt;
switch ($monitorCount) {&lt;br /&gt;
    1 { $suffix = &amp;#039; (Primär)&amp;#039; }&lt;br /&gt;
    2 { $suffix = &amp;#039; (Sekundär)&amp;#039; }&lt;br /&gt;
    3 { $suffix = &amp;#039; (Tertiär)&amp;#039; }&lt;br /&gt;
    4 { $suffix = &amp;#039; (Quartär)&amp;#039; }&lt;br /&gt;
    5 { $suffix = &amp;#039; (Quinär)&amp;#039; }&lt;br /&gt;
    6 { $suffix = &amp;#039; (Senär)&amp;#039; }&lt;br /&gt;
    7 { $suffix = &amp;#039; (Septenär)&amp;#039; }&lt;br /&gt;
    8 { $suffix = &amp;#039; (Octonär)&amp;#039; }&lt;br /&gt;
    9 { $suffix = &amp;#039; (Nonär)&amp;#039; }&lt;br /&gt;
    10 { $suffix = &amp;#039; (Denär)&amp;#039; }&lt;br /&gt;
    default { $suffix = &amp;#039;&amp;#039; }&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
    $label = New-Object System.Windows.Forms.Label&lt;br /&gt;
    $label.Text = &amp;quot;Monitor $monitorCount $suffix&amp;quot;&lt;br /&gt;
    $label.ForeColor = &amp;#039;White&amp;#039;&lt;br /&gt;
    $label.Font = New-Object System.Drawing.Font(&amp;#039;Segoe UI&amp;#039;, 36, [System.Drawing.FontStyle]::Bold)&lt;br /&gt;
    $label.AutoSize = $false&lt;br /&gt;
    $label.Dock = &amp;#039;Fill&amp;#039;&lt;br /&gt;
    $label.TextAlign = &amp;#039;MiddleCenter&amp;#039;&lt;br /&gt;
    $form.Controls.Add($label)&lt;br /&gt;
&lt;br /&gt;
    $forms += $form&lt;br /&gt;
    $monitorCount++&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
# Timer schließt alle Formulare gleichzeitig nach Intervall (ms)&lt;br /&gt;
$closeInterval = 3000&lt;br /&gt;
$timer = New-Object System.Windows.Forms.Timer&lt;br /&gt;
$timer.Interval = $closeInterval&lt;br /&gt;
$timer.Add_Tick({&lt;br /&gt;
    $timer.Stop()&lt;br /&gt;
    foreach ($f in $forms) { if ($f -and -not $f.IsDisposed) { $f.Close() } }&lt;br /&gt;
    $context.ExitThread()&lt;br /&gt;
})&lt;br /&gt;
$timer.Start()&lt;br /&gt;
&lt;br /&gt;
# Alle Formulare sichtbar machen (gleichzeitig) und Message-Loop starten&lt;br /&gt;
foreach ($f in $forms) { $f.Show() }&lt;br /&gt;
[System.Windows.Forms.Application]::Run($context)&amp;lt;/nowiki&amp;gt;&amp;lt;/pre&amp;gt;&lt;br /&gt;
&lt;br /&gt;
Das Skript kann in eine Textdatei kopiert und als Identify_Monitors_middle_SONDER.ps1 abgespeichert werden. Mögliche Formate sind UTF-8, UTF-8 mit BOM, UTF-16 LB, UTF-16 LE oder ANSI. &lt;br /&gt;
&lt;br /&gt;
Das Skript muss dann per Rechtsklick mit PowerShell ausgeführt werden.&lt;br /&gt;
&lt;br /&gt;
Wir haben es einmal fertig gepackt als [https://www.deskmodder.de/blog/wp-content/uploads/2026/04/identify-monitors-middle-sonder.zip identify-monitors-middle-sonder.zip] zum Herunterladen bereitgestellt.&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
{{Absatz}}&lt;br /&gt;
{{Fragen11}}&lt;/div&gt;</summary>
		<author><name>Moinmoin</name></author>
	</entry>
</feed>